Date: Wed, 14 Jul 2021 14:59:31 +0000 (GMT) [thread overview] Message-ID: <20210714145931.EF9963860C37@sourceware.org> (raw) https://sourceware.org/git/gitweb.cgi?p=glibc.git;h=0e1f068108d94576321bbbd354cfb1b3b99389bf commit 0e1f068108d94576321bbbd354cfb1b3b99389bf Author: Stefan Liebler <stli@linux.ibm.com> Date: Wed Jul 14 15:58:08 2021 +0200 Fix linknamespace errors and local-plt-usages in nss_files. After commit f9c8b11ed7726b858cd7b7cea0d3d7c5233d78cf "nss: Access nss_files through direct references", when building with -Os, multiple conform/.../linknamespace tests and elf/check-localplt are failing: Extra PLT reference: libc.so: fgetc_unlocked Extra PLT reference: libc.so: getline Or e.g.: [initial] glob -> [libc.a(glob.o)] __getpwnam_r -> [libc.a(getpwnam_r.o)] __nss_database_custom -> [libc.a(nsswitch.o)] __nss_module_get_function -> [libc.a(nss_module.o)] __nss_files_functions -> [libc.a(nss_files_functions.o)] _nss_files_endaliasent -> [libc.a(files-alias.o)] feof_unlocked [initial] glob -> [libc.a(glob.o)] __getpwnam_r -> [libc.a(getpwnam_r.o)] __nss_database_custom -> [libc.a(nsswitch.o)] __nss_module_get_function -> [libc.a(nss_module.o)] __nss_files_functions -> [libc.a(nss_files_functions.o)] _nss_files_endaliasent -> [libc.a(files-alias.o)] fgetc_unlocked [initial] glob -> [libc.a(glob.o)] __getpwnam_r -> [libc.a(getpwnam_r.o)] __nss_database_custom -> [libc.a(nsswitch.o)] __nss_module_get_function -> [libc.a(nss_module.o)] __nss_files_functions -> [libc.a(nss_files_functions.o)] _nss_files_endnetgrent -> [libc.a(files-netgrp.o)] getline This patch is using the hidden symbols where possible. Instead of fputc_unlocked, __putc_unlocked is used. (Compare to commit eeaa19f75e52d2d48074ae0c423f2311d67c42c6 "mntent: Use __putc_unlocked instead of fputc_unlocked") Diff: --- nss/nss_files/files-alias.c | 4 ++-- nss/nss_files/files-initgroups.c | 4 ++-- nss/nss_files/files-netgrp.c | 6 +++--- nss/nss_readline.c | 2 +- 4 files changed, 8 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-) diff --git a/nss/nss_files/files-alias.c b/nss/nss_files/files-alias.c index 8c6e176ff6..2a4023b9a9 100644 --- a/nss/nss_files/files-alias.c +++ b/nss/nss_files/files-alias.c @@ -189,7 +189,7 @@ get_next_alias (FILE *stream, const char *match, struct aliasent *result, if (listfile != NULL && (old_line = __strdup (line)) != NULL) { - while (! feof_unlocked (listfile)) + while (! __feof_unlocked (listfile)) { if (room_left < 2) { @@ -269,7 +269,7 @@ get_next_alias (FILE *stream, const char *match, struct aliasent *result, just read character. */ int ch; - ch = fgetc_unlocked (stream); + ch = __getc_unlocked (stream); if (ch == EOF || ch == '\n' || !isspace (ch)) { size_t cnt; diff --git a/nss/nss_files/files-initgroups.c b/nss/nss_files/files-initgroups.c index b44211e50b..d221335902 100644 --- a/nss/nss_files/files-initgroups.c +++ b/nss/nss_files/files-initgroups.c @@ -55,10 +55,10 @@ _nss_files_initgroups_dyn (const char *user, gid_t group, long int *start, { fpos_t pos; fgetpos (stream, &pos); - ssize_t n = getline (&line, &linelen, stream); + ssize_t n = __getline (&line, &linelen, stream); if (n < 0) { - if (! feof_unlocked (stream)) + if (! __feof_unlocked (stream)) status = ((*errnop = errno) == ENOMEM ? NSS_STATUS_TRYAGAIN : NSS_STATUS_UNAVAIL); break; diff --git a/nss/nss_files/files-netgrp.c b/nss/nss_files/files-netgrp.c index 75bfbd9e44..82cc201b85 100644 --- a/nss/nss_files/files-netgrp.c +++ b/nss/nss_files/files-netgrp.c @@ -77,9 +77,9 @@ _nss_files_setnetgrent (const char *group, struct __netgrent *result) status = NSS_STATUS_NOTFOUND; result->cursor = result->data; - while (!feof_unlocked (fp)) + while (!__feof_unlocked (fp)) { - ssize_t curlen = getline (&line, &line_len, fp); + ssize_t curlen = __getline (&line, &line_len, fp); int found; if (curlen < 0) @@ -111,7 +111,7 @@ _nss_files_setnetgrent (const char *group, struct __netgrent *result) result->cursor -= 2; /* Get next line. */ - curlen = getline (&line, &line_len, fp); + curlen = __getline (&line, &line_len, fp); if (curlen <= 0) break; diff --git a/nss/nss_readline.c b/nss/nss_readline.c index a2f397a11f..ddf2b8962f 100644 --- a/nss/nss_readline.c +++ b/nss/nss_readline.c @@ -42,7 +42,7 @@ __nss_readline (FILE *fp, char *buf, size_t len, off64_t *poffset) buf[len - 1] = '\xff'; /* Marker to recognize truncation. */ if (__fgets_unlocked (buf, len, fp) == NULL) { - if (feof_unlocked (fp)) + if (__feof_unlocked (fp)) { __set_errno (ENOENT); return ENOENT;
